PHIL 327 - American Pragmatism(3.00) An examination of the origin and development of the American pragmatist movements, from their beginnings with Pierce, James and Dewey, to contemporary pragmatists such as Quine. The course compares the merits of the pragmatic method with those of rationalist and empiricist methodologies.
Course ID: 56035 Consent: No Special Consent Required Components: Lecture Requirement Group: You must have taken (1) PHIL course and received a grade of “C” or better before taking this course.
